At first glance, one solution is to stream the mjpeg Webcam images and use [B4X] [class] MJPEG decoder (https://www.b4x.com/android/forum/threads/b4x-class-mjpeg-decoder.73702/) to display on Samsung phone.
Don't know if Logitech included such software for streaming with hd webcam on Windows; if you google, you can find solutions with Linux and RPi.

Also you can use B4J to save the image with this class https://www.b4x.com/android/forum/threads/class-webcam-capture.53211/ and configure a http server to display the image
